Purpose of the conference:
The purpose of the conference: to discuss and publish achievements in the field of scientific instrument making, to establish and strengthen professional ties between scientists, specialists of enterprises and organizations, as well as young researchers, to increase the efficiency of using scientific and technical potential in solving priority scientific and practical problems of instrument making development.
According to the results of the conference, the best reports will be selected for publication in the scientific journals "Physical Fundamentals of Instrument Engineering" (VAK, RSCI) and "Science of the South-Russia" (VAK, RSCI).

Rules for drafting articles
ile name: direction number _ Last name of the first author.doc.
For example: 1_Petrov.docx
Materials language - Russian or English.
The volume is not more than 2 pages of A4 format.
Page and text options - Times New Roman font; interval 1.15 pt; font size 11; margins: upper and lower - 2.0 cm, left - 3.0 cm, right - 1.5 cm.
Drawings are color with a resolution of 300 dpi, with the extension tif or jpeg. All drawings are placed in the text of the article (they must be numbered and signed), and also sent additionally as separate files.
The name of the picture file.
For example: 1_Petrov_Ris. 1
Graphs, diagrams and diagrams should be drawn in the form of a picture.
Placeholders should be placed directly below the image (without a dot at the end of the signature).
For example: Fig. 1. Appearance of the developed device: a) container, sensor; b) view of a detachable bathytermosalinograph XCTD without a container; c) detachable probe circuit
References to figures in the text are required.
For example: (Fig. 1)
Formulas are typed by combining the main font and the Symbol font (exception for fractions, sums, square root) in Microsoft Equation 3.0 (Formula Editor in Microsoft Word) or Math Type 6. Latin signs in formulas and designations (both in text and in drawings) are typed in italics. Greek signs in formulas are indicated by a direct style.
Formula numbering should be done after the formula in parentheses.
For example: (1).
Only the formulas and equations referred to in the following statement should be numbered.
Tables should be placed in the text of the article, they should have a numbered title and clearly marked columns, convenient and understandable for reading. These tables should correspond to the numbers in the text, but should not duplicate the information provided in it.
Place table labels above them (without a period at the end of the label).
For example: Table 1. Total fertility rate by regions of Russia
References to tables in the text are required.
For example: (Table 1)
The bibliographic list is placed after the main text of the article and is issued in compliance with GOST R 7.0.5-2008. A bibliographic description of borrowed sources, as well as cited literature, is given by a general list at the end of the article alphabetically (first in Cyrillic, then in Latin).
In-text references to articles should be presented in square brackets.
For example: [1], when enumerating [3,4] or [5-7].
The reference list shall contain works mentioned in the text according to the serial number of the source specified in the text. References in the text of the article are submitted to all sources specified in the List of References, to research sources (scientific articles, monographs, etc.), including foreign ones.
